/learnings
End-of-session compound learning capture. Mirrors the docs/solutions ritual that Boris Cherny popularised at Every — every non-trivial session writes 0–3 entries that the next session can find by grep.
When to Run
- At the end of any session that involved real debugging, design decisions, or surprises (i.e., basically every session).
- Not on typo / one-line / cosmetic sessions. Skip then.
- Not on routine "rebase + push" maintenance unless something broke.
The Iron Law
ONLY write a learning when something was SURPRISING or NON-OBVIOUS.
NEVER duplicate a learning that already exists in docs/solutions/.
NEVER write a "what I did" diary — that's the PR description's job.
A learning answers "what would have saved me 30 minutes today?"
If nothing in the session meets that bar, the right answer is to write zero entries. Empty output is allowed and expected.
Process
Step 1: Scan the session
Walk the conversation. Pull out anything that fits one of:
- Bug archaeology — root cause was non-obvious; future-me would benefit from the writeup. (e.g., "p.r vs part.r refactor leftover was throwing ReferenceError because the loop variable was renamed in only half the file.")
- Workflow gotcha — a tool/process behaviour that wasted time and is recoverable from. (e.g., "Vite dev server tunnels straight to cloudflared — committing fixes the deploy, no separate build step.")
- Architectural decision with a rationale — picked X over Y, the reason isn't in the code. (e.g., "FABRIK over CCD because chains are short and we need preserved bone lengths exactly.")
- Cross-repo or contract subtlety — something that touches GA + ix / Demerzel / tars and the linkage isn't documented elsewhere.
- API quirk — third-party service or library with surprising
behaviour. (e.g., "GraphQL
metadatareturns numbers not strings despite TS type saying Record<string,string>.") - Performance / scaling surprise — a path that's slower or faster than expected, with the why.
